hippieman posted:I'm not trying to bash, I love the iPhone, I'm an iPhone developer. For some reason mine takes lovely pictures. I think I got something on the lens that I can't get off. But you'll never expose indoors and outdoors in the same shot because of the extreme difference in brightness. On any camera. (of course unless you use a flash, or a 2 exposure tone mapping) I'd say your picture was exposed properly to show you desktop, but to someone who knows nothing, it could be seen as "ZOMG something the iPhone can't do!".
